Architecture and operational tradeoff analysis
Private cloud ERP is typically selected when healthcare organizations require dedicated environments, stricter segmentation, custom network controls, or more deterministic governance over upgrades and validation cycles. This is common in environments with complex EHR integrations, imaging systems, laboratory systems, revenue cycle dependencies, or regional data handling requirements. The architecture can reduce operational ambiguity, but it also places greater responsibility on the provider and partner to maintain patching, backup validation, disaster recovery testing, and infrastructure lifecycle management.
Public cloud ERP is often favored when the organization prioritizes modernization speed, geographic scalability, API-led interoperability, and access to adjacent cloud services such as analytics, AI tooling, event-driven integration, and managed databases. In healthcare, this can be attractive for multi-site provider groups, digital health operators, and organizations consolidating fragmented back-office systems. However, public cloud does not remove compliance obligations. It shifts them into a shared responsibility model that requires disciplined identity management, logging, encryption governance, workload segmentation, and vendor oversight.
From an ERP reseller platform comparison perspective, private cloud tends to support higher-touch managed services and stronger account stickiness, while public cloud can support faster scale and more standardized service delivery. The strategic question is not which cloud is universally better, but which deployment model aligns with the customer's risk tolerance, operational maturity, and the partner's recurring revenue strategy.
Compliance, governance, and operational resilience considerations
Healthcare ERP deployment decisions are frequently influenced by auditability, access governance, business continuity, and vendor accountability. Private cloud can simplify governance narratives for organizations that want dedicated tenancy, controlled maintenance windows, and explicit infrastructure boundaries. This can be valuable where internal compliance teams or external auditors prefer clearly documented operational ownership.
Public cloud can still meet demanding regulatory requirements, but success depends on governance maturity. Organizations need clear policies for identity federation, privileged access, encryption key management, retention controls, incident response, and third-party risk management. For partners, this creates a managed services opportunity: governance-as-a-service, compliance monitoring, backup assurance, and operational resilience testing become recurring revenue layers rather than one-time project tasks.

Licensing model comparison: unlimited users vs per-user licensing in healthcare ERP
Licensing model design materially affects ERP adoption in healthcare. Per-user licensing can appear cost-efficient at the start, but it often creates friction as organizations expand access to finance teams, procurement staff, supply chain users, satellite clinics, outsourced service teams, and executive stakeholders. In regulated operations, restricted access can unintentionally encourage shadow workflows, shared credentials, or delayed process adoption, all of which weaken governance.
Unlimited-user ERP comparison is especially relevant in healthcare environments with broad operational participation. Unlimited users can support cleaner workflow adoption, stronger auditability, and easier expansion across departments without recurring licensing negotiations. For partners, unlimited-user models can simplify commercial packaging and improve customer retention because growth does not immediately trigger licensing disputes.
Per-user licensing remains viable where user populations are tightly controlled or where the ERP footprint is narrow. But in multi-entity healthcare groups or organizations pursuing shared services, it can become a long-term margin and adoption constraint. Partners should evaluate not only software list price, but also the behavioral effect of licensing on process participation, governance quality, and support complexity.

Pricing, TCO, and operational ROI analysis
Healthcare ERP TCO should be evaluated across software licensing, infrastructure, security tooling, compliance operations, integration maintenance, backup and disaster recovery, support staffing, and change management. Private cloud may present higher upfront or baseline operating costs because dedicated resources, environment design, and governance controls are more customized. However, for stable and predictable workloads, private cloud can produce cost clarity and reduce the risk of uncontrolled consumption growth.
Public cloud often lowers initial deployment barriers and can reduce infrastructure administration overhead, but variable usage, data egress, premium managed services, and under-governed environments can erode expected savings. In healthcare, where integrations, reporting, and retention requirements can be substantial, cloud cost management discipline is essential. FinOps should be treated as a governance function, not an afterthought.
Operational ROI should also include non-financial outcomes: faster onboarding of acquired clinics, improved audit readiness, reduced downtime risk, broader workflow adoption, and lower dependency on manual controls. For partners, ROI extends to service attach rate, renewal stability, support efficiency, and the ability to standardize delivery across accounts.
Realistic evaluation scenarios
Scenario one: A regional hospital group with legacy finance systems, complex procurement controls, and multiple clinical integration points may favor private cloud ERP. The organization needs controlled upgrade windows, dedicated segmentation, and a partner-managed compliance operating model. In this case, private cloud supports lower operational disruption risk and gives the partner room to deliver premium managed services under a white-label platform model.
Scenario two: A fast-growing outpatient network expanding through acquisition may favor public cloud ERP. The priority is rapid site onboarding, standardized workflows, API-based integration, and scalable reporting. A partner can package a managed public cloud platform with governance templates, identity controls, and recurring support services. This model may produce faster deployment velocity and stronger multi-site standardization.
Scenario three: A healthcare distributor serving regulated supply chains may choose a hybrid path, beginning in private cloud to preserve specialized integrations and moving selected analytics or collaboration workloads into public cloud services over time. This phased modernization approach can reduce migration risk while allowing the partner to expand recurring revenue through staged platform operations.
Migration, interoperability, and ecosystem maturity
ERP migration comparison in healthcare should account for more than data conversion. Partners must assess interface dependencies, identity architecture, reporting obligations, archival requirements, validation procedures, and downstream process impacts. Private cloud can be advantageous when migration requires temporary coexistence with legacy systems or custom network pathways. Public cloud can be advantageous when modernization includes API-first integration, event-driven workflows, and broader digital platform consolidation.
Ecosystem maturity also matters. Public cloud ecosystems generally offer broader native tooling, marketplace integrations, and automation frameworks. Private cloud ecosystems can be highly effective when delivered by mature managed platform providers with healthcare-specific governance patterns. Buyers should evaluate not just vendor claims, but the practical maturity of partner support models, escalation paths, documentation quality, and operational accountability.
